The cheapest way to get from Whitechapel to Inverness is to bus which costs £60 - £140 and takes 14h 10m.
The fastest way to get from Whitechapel to Inverness is to fly which takes 5h and costs £65 - £310.
No, there is no direct bus from Whitechapel to Inverness station. However, there are services departing from The East London Mosque and arriving at Bus Station Stance 3 via Baker Street Station, Finchley Road / O2 Centre and Edinburgh, Bus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 14h 10m.
No, there is no direct train from Whitechapel station to Inverness. However, there are services departing from Whitechapel station and arriving at Inverness via King's Cross.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 9h 19m.
The distance between Whitechapel and Inverness is 475 miles. The road distance is 532.2 miles.
The best way to get from Whitechapel to Inverness without a car is to train via King's Cross St. Pancras station which takes 9h 19m and costs £200 - £290.
It takes approximately 5h to get from Whitechapel to Inverness, including transfers.
Whitechapel to Inverness bus services, operated by FlixBus, depart from Finchley Road / O2 Centre station.
Whitechapel to Inverness train services, operated by London North Eastern Railway Limited (LNER), depart from King's Cross station.
The best way to get from Whitechapel to Inverness is to fly which takes 5h and costs £65 - £310. Alternatively, you can train via King's Cross St. Pancras station, which costs £200 - £290 and takes 9h 19m, you could also bus, which costs £60 - £140 and takes 14h 10m.
What companies run services between Whitechapel, Greater London, England and Inverness, Scotland?
British Airways, Loganair, and KLM fly from London Heathrow Airport (LHR) to Inverness Dalcross Airport (INV) 4 times a day. Alternatively, London North Eastern Railway Limited (LNER) operates a train from King's Cross to Inverness once daily. Tickets cost £200–280 and the journey takes 8h 2m.
